Description

On this tour, you’ll cross the Charles River and enter the City of Cambridge. Renowned as one of America’s most bicycle-friendly cities, you will experience the atmosphere and appeal of Cambridge as only possible on two wheels. Touted as “Boston’s Left Bank,” Cambridge is a hotspot of arts, technology, and academia. This extensive tour, specifically designed to provide you with the overall experience of Cambridge, includes: • Harvard Square, the heart of America’s oldest university • Central Square, a vibrant center of music and culture • The beautiful Charles River • The Stata Center, Frank Gehry’s only building in Massachusetts • MIT, The Massachusetts Institute of Technology The tour is 2.5-3 hours long and covers 11-13 miles. From the cycling paths on the Charles River to the booming industry of Kendall Square, this tour will show you the most exciting and vibrant parts of Cambridge! If you are 16 years or older, you may chose to tour on E-bike (select E-bike in checkout).

Itinerary

Admission included30 min

Arrive at our shop 30 minutes prior to your tour time. You'll be asked to sign a waiver and be fitted on your bike. You guide will provide an overview of the ride, what to expect, as well as our safety tips and rules of the road.

Pass by

Our ride will start in the North End, Boston's Italian neighborhood. You will likely smell the garlic as we roll through. At the end of your tour, you guide will be happy to recommend a restaurant or pastry shop (mmm...cannolis!)

Pass by

Curious to know the inspiration behind Boston's new(ish) bridge? Our guides will let you know a few fun facts behind the design...

Pass by

Pass by Boston's famous Museum of Science.

Pass by

Ride along the path on the Cambridge side of the Charles River, where you'll enjoy great views of the Boston skyline.

Pass by

Ride through Kendall Square

5 min

Ride through MIT, and see some of the notable buildings and architecture on campus.

Pass by

Ride by the MIT Museum.

5 min

Ride by the Stata Center, designed by renowned architect Frank Gehry.

Pass by

Ride through Central Square

5 min

We'll stop in famous Harvard Yard (or as your guide may pronounce it "Havahd Yahd"...)

Pass by

Pass by Harvard Square, where many of our guests return to explore during their visit to Boston (and Cambridge!)

Pass by

Our route will take us along the river on the Esplanade, where we'll ride by the Hatch Shell, the outdoor concert stage which was made famous by the Boston Pops Orchestra, which performs during the Fourth of July fireworks.

Pass by

Along our route, we'll ride past TD Garden, home of the Boston Bruins, Boston Celtics, and many a concert!
